This presentation is for writers who are working on a manuscript and dream of one day publishing it. We’ll talk about the massive changes that have swept through the publishing industry, and the opportunities and challenges that have resulted for authors. The presentation is designed to help writers make informed decisions and plan their path to publication.
Presenters:
- Hallie Ephron (http://hallieephron.com), Milton’s 2023-2024 Dr. Herb Voigt Writer in Residence, is the New York Times bestselling author of 16 traditionally published books, including eleven mystery novels and Edgar Award finalist Writing & Selling Your Mystery Novel.
- Sharon Ward (https://sharonward.com) is the author of self-published books including six thrillers and an information-packed guide to self-publishing, Smart Self-Publishing Strategies.

The Milton Public Library Writer-in-Residence is an aspiring or published writer, residing in Milton, MA who furthers the library’s fundamental mission through the creation of an original piece of work and sharing their expertise through developing and offering library programming. Herb Voigt was a member of the Library Board of Trustees from 2012 until his passing in 2018. Herb was a committed Library supporter, both as a Trustee and a member of the Milton Library Foundation. In addition to Herb’s distinguished scientific and academic career, he was a lover and supporter of the arts. This Writer-in-Residence program celebrates Herb’s commitment to libraries and to the arts.
